The overview below groups typical Laurel Removal proj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Marion, IA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Removal Jobs - Typically, local contractors charge between $250 and $600 for removing small amounts of laurel or individual plants. Many routine jobs fall within this range, especially for straightforward removal tasks around residential properties.
Medium-Sized Projects - Larger removal projects, such as clearing multiple bushes or a section of a landscape, usually cost between $600 and $1,500. These are common for homeowners looking to overhaul a garden or prepare for new planting.
Full Shrub Removal - Complete removal of dense laurel hedges or several large shrubs can range from $1,500 to $3,000 depending on size and accessibility. Fewer projects reach this tier, as most are moderate in scope.
Complete Landscape Overhaul - Extensive removal involving large-scale landscaping or significant site preparation can exceed $5,000. Such projects are less frequent but are handled by local pros experienced in major landscape transformations.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
